I never thought to look for the LP on Abebooks Dave.

The duo did record two others, one on trout fishing and one on carp recorded at Cave Castle Lake in the East Riding of Yorkshire which was rented by a group of seven of us as the East Riding Specimen Group. I don't think they were released.

We stocked the lake with carp, some bought through Jack Hilton who was thinning out some of the smaller Redmire fish.
